Kaunda condemns metered taxi violence at murdered Taxify driver's funeral
Updated | By Nushera Soodyal
The KZN born Taxify driver who was locked in his boot before his car was set alight in Pretoria has been laid to rest in Inanda, north of Durban.

21-year-old Siyabonga Ngcobo - who had been studying at the Tshwane University of Technology - was kidnapped earlier this month.
KZN Transport, MEC Mxolisi Kaunda attended the funeral yesterday.

His spokesperson, Mluleki Mntungwa says Ngcobo got into Taxify to make extra money.
"Speaking at his funeral - the MEC called on all stakeholders to learn to resolve their conflicts through constructive engagement instead of resorting to violence. 21-year-old Siyabonga was a final year student at TUT but he also ventured into this business so that he can earn a living while pursuing his studies," Mntungwa said.
